Key trio re-sign for beleaguered Blues

Three key re-signings have boosted the under-siege Blues as they look to resurrect this year’s Super Rugby campaign.

Charlie Faumuina, captain Luke Braid and Tom McCartney have each signed two-year deals with the franchise.

With just one win from 10 matches, the Blues are anchored to the bottom of the New Zealand conference, also sitting last on the overall table.

But prop Faumuina says he’s committed to the struggling franchise, and is determined to play his role in the team’s revival for 2013 and 2014.

“I enjoy being part of the Blues, I’m proud to wear the jersey and I’m determined more than ever to do what I can to help get this team get back to where it should be.”

Braid and McCartney are also confident that better times are ahead for the Blues.

“There’s no doubt we’re doing it tough this year, but the Blues environment is a good one and I want to keep on being a part of it,” Braid said.

McCartney says the chance to keep developing his game alongside experienced campaigners like Keven Mealamu and Tony Woodcock played a big part in his decision.
